TP官方网址下载_tpwallet官网下载|IOS版/安卓版/最新版本app下载-tp官网
<strong dir="6tvmx"></strong>
<center lang="zxx"></center><acronym id="aso"></acronym><code dropzone="ed1"></code><time lang="7w5"></time><em draggable="qqc"></em><strong dropzone="573"></strong><noscript lang="6y8"></noscript>

TPWallet 添加以太坊节点的全面方案与实践分析

<legend dir="k8w7dk"></legend><style date-time="w9gd52"></style><bdo id="j72ldq"></bdo><bdo id="1evbpq"></bdo><kbd lang="2irn__"></kbd><tt draggable="qqqffe"></tt>

摘要:本文面向TPWallet在移动/桌面端添加以太坊节点的需求,给出节点类型选择、实际接入配置、以及围绕高效交易系统、多链支付保护、客服支持、加密存储、市场分析、资产管理与便捷支付流程的全方位设计与落地建议。

1. 节点接入与配置建议

- 节点类型:推荐根据业务场景选择公共RPC(Infura/Alchemy/QuickNode)+自建轻节点(Geth light/Erigon snap/light)或WebSocket连接的归档/归档缓存节点。公共RPC适合快速上线,自建节点保证数据可控与高并发。

- 基本参数:配置RPC URL、WS URL、chainId=1、请求超时、重试策略;同步模式选择fast/snap满足历史查询需求;是否开启archive视账户历史需求决定。

- 安全与限流:IP白名单、API Key、TLS、请求签名、速率限制、熔断与退避。

- 高可用:多节点负载均衡、读写分离(写到主RPC,读到缓存节点)、健康检查与自动切换。

2. 高效交易系统设计

- Nonce管理:集中化nonce管理与并发排队避免重放/冲突。

- 交易池与打包:本地交易队列、批量发送、并行签名;优先级策略依据gas price/用户等级动态调整。

- Gas策略:实时链上gas oracle、预估+上浮、用户可选加速;支持EIP-1559参数管理(maxFeePerGas, maxPriorityFeePerGas)。

- 性能优化:使用WebSocket订阅交易回执、并行RPC调用、缓存代币元数据和ABI,减少链上查询频次。

3. 多链支付保护

- 跨链网关与桥接:集成可信桥(以太->Layer2/其他链),并对桥接交易加签与监控。

- 回滚与补偿机制:在跨链失败时自动通知并启动补偿流程(退款或重试)。

- 风险控制:风控策略(黑名单地址、异常速率检测、滑点/价格阈值)、多重签名/多方签名(MPC)对高额支付保护。

4. 客服支持与运维

- 观测与报警:链上/节点/交易/钱包异常指标(TPS、延迟、失败率、内存/CPU)、日志集中与可视化。

- 工单与用户沟通:快捷退款流程、交易详情一键查询(txhash、区块高度、状态)、常见问题知识库与主动告知。

- 事故响应:标准SLA、应急预案、回滚步骤与数据保全。

5. 加密存储与密钥管理

- 私钥方案:HD钱包(BIP32/39/44)+助记词保护,移动端使用系统Keystore/Keychain/TEE;服务器端使用HSM或MPC方案存储敏感密钥。

- 签名策略:客户端签名优先;需要托管签名时采用阈值签名与多签控制权限。

- 备份与恢复:加密备份、冷备份、多重验证重置流程、定期密钥轮换策略。

6. 市场分析与经济性考量

- 节点成本:自建节点(硬件、存储、带宽、维护)与第三方RPC费用对比;归档节点成本显著高于轻节点。

- 费用敏感性:链上手续费波动对用户留存影响,需结合Gas优化、聚合套利与Layer2拆单策略降低成本。

- 竞争分析:评估主流钱包功能(Swap、桥、Fiat on/off ramp、社交恢复)与差异化服务定位。

7. 资产管理与账务一致性

- 余额同步:定期与实时双路径同步(on-chain查询+事件订阅),对代币余额做本地缓存并定期对账。

- 代币支持:ERC-20/721/1155元数据缓存、价格喂价接入、风险识别(自定义合约、模糊代码审计)。

- 审计与流水:可追溯的账务流水、txhash关联、自动对账报告与导出功能。

8. 便捷支付流程设计

- 流程简化:一键支付、智能gas估算、支付前预览(手续费、汇率)、支持扫码与链接支付。

- UX优化:分步确认、支付模板、支付失败可视化原因与一键重试、支付速度与成功率提示。

- 免gas/代付:引入Paymaster或meta-transaction方案允许商家或服务端代付手续费提升转化率。

9. 实施步骤(快速清单)

- 评估需求(并发、历史查询、费用)→ 选择RPC(自建/第三方)→ 配置RPC/WS与chainId→ 实现nonce管理与交易队列→ 集成监控与报警→ 加密存储与备份→ 进行压力测试与安全扫描→ 逐步灰度发布并建立客服SOP。

结语:为TPWallet加入以太坊节点不仅是技术接入,还涉及交易效率、安全保障、运营支持与产品体验的协同工程。推荐采用公共RPC + 自建轻节点的混合策略、实现集中化交易控制与分布式签名保护,并用监控与客服闭环确保用户体验与资产安全。

作者:陈思远 发布时间:2026-01-05 21:07:26

相关阅读
<em id="cesby"></em><address draggable="dle6r"></address><font id="uc174"></font><small id="md6wq"></small><time dir="9qo5p"></time><u dir="7afo5"></u><tt date-time="b5j57"></tt>